Since all state waters are interconnected, by cleaning up and reducing litter on local rivers, creeks and lakes, we prevent storms from flushing that trash downstream to the coastline. In fact, studies have found that 80 percent of trash on our beaches originated from an inland source.

The events are scheduled just before the first heavy rainfall of the autumn and winter seasons. The less trash along our roadways, riverbanks and coastlines, the less that flows untreated into our waterways. For this reason, Caltrans reminds drivers to tarp and secure their loads on roof carriers and in truck beds. Travelers can also prevent trash from blowing out of car windows by designating a vehicle garbage bag and properly disposing of it at a rest area or final destination.
